摘要
目的建立衍生化-富集-表面增强拉曼光谱法快速检测奶粉中亚硝酸盐的分析方法。方法样品水溶液通过除蛋白、衍生化后,采用阳离子小柱PSY-001对衍生化合物进行富集,再使用表面增强拉曼光谱对样品中的亚硝酸盐含量进行定性检测。结果7类不同奶粉,采用本研究所建立的方法进行检测,根据不同的批处理量,单个样品检测全过程只需3~15min,定性检测限为0.4mg/kg,远低于国家安全标准对亚硝酸盐的限量要求(2 mg/kg)。方法的灵敏度在96%~100%,特异性为100%,假阴性率为0%~4%,假阳性率为0%,相对准确度为98%~100%。结论该方法操作简单、快速,易于掌握,适用于奶粉中亚硝酸盐的快速筛查。
Objective To eatablish a method for the rapid detection of nitrite in milk powder by derivatization-enrichment-surface enhanced Raman spectroscopy.Methods The aqueous solutions of samples were deproteinized and derivatized,and the derived compounds were enriched by cationic cartridge PSY-01,finally,the nitrite in samples were qualitative detected by surface enhanced Raman spectroscopy.Results Seven kinds of milk powders were tested by this method,which took only 3-15 minutes per sample,depending on batch processing capacity.The limits of detection(LOD)of this method was 0.4 mg/kg and much less than maximum residue limit(MRL)of nitrite specified in national food safety standard of China(2 mg/kg).The sensitivity of this method was 96%-100%,the specificity was 100%,the false negative rate was 0%-4%,the false positive rate was 0%,and the relative accuracy was 98%-100%.Conclusion This method is simple,quick and easy to operate,and therefore suitable for the rapid screening of nitrite in milk powder.
